Ripley extended their winning streak to five on Thursday, bumping them up to 5-0. They blew past the Garber Wolverines 11-1. Fans of the Warriors have seen this all before: every one of the games they've played this season has ended in a blowout of 6+ runs.
As for Garber, they are on a six-game losing streak (dating back to last season) that has dropped them down to 0-4. That's two games in a row now that they have lost by exactly ten runs.
For Garber's part, they saw three different players step up and record at least one hit. One of them was Kacin Hughes, who went a perfect 1-for-1 with one run. Keiton Wills also deserves some recognition as he got his first hit of the season.
Both squads are looking forward to the support of their home crowds in their upcoming games. Ripley will welcome Pawnee at 4:30 p.m. on Friday. As for Garber, they will host Lomega at 12:15 p.m. on Thursday.
